1963 Gibson J-50 Guitar

(Serial No. 99408) Excellent condition. The J-50 is the same guitar as the J-45 but with a natural top. This guitar is a pickers dream - there are no structural repairs, the guitar has the original frets which were just dressed, and it has the adjustable saddle with a wooden insert. I usually change the wooden saddle out for ceramic, but this guitar sounded so good I left it. The guitar has mahogany back and sides, a solid Sitka spruce top with the desirable tall thin bracing (similar to early Hummingbirds), and a Brazilian rosewood fretboard with pearl dot inlays. Decal logo. Neck is straight, frets are good. Finish and hardware are original. The action is nice and low. Shows very minor playing wear. This is a excellent sounding nicely aged Gibson. Comes with a newer hardshell case.
